Protein Function

For consistent comparison across experiments, use this antibody to explore Synemin (SYNM) with a repeatable workflow. Synemin is a cytoskeletal element that contributes to cell shape, mechanics, and motility. Use matched handling so differences reflect biology rather than processing.

In some datasets and protocols, it is referenced by the gene symbol SYNM.

Targets:
SYNM
Research Area:
Cardiovascular
Application:
IF • IHC • WB
Reactivity:
Human • Mouse • Rat
Host:
Rat
Clonality:
Polyclonal
Isotype:
IgG
Immunogen:
Synthetic peptide (17-aa) derived from the N-terminal region of mouse synemin protein
Conjugation:
Unconjugated
Purification:
Affinity Chromatography
Concentration:
0.25 mg/ml
UniProt:
O15061
Homology:
Synthetic peptide sequence is identical to rat sequence (showing 94.1% homology to human sequence)
Storage Buffer:
PBS, pH 7.2, 0.1% Sodium Azide
Storage Temperature:
-20°C
